Web1 apr. 2024 · The site’s major structures include five pyramidal temples and three large complexes, often called acropoles; these presumably were temples and palaces for the upper class. One such complex is … Temple II (also known as the Temple of the Mask) it was built around AD 700 and stands 38 meters (125 ft) high. Like other major temples at Tikal, the summit shrine had three consecutive chambers with the doorways spanned by wooden lintels, only the middle of which was carved. WebTemple V is located in the southern part of Tikal's site core, upon an east-west ridge that also supports the Lost World complex, the Plaza of the Seven Temples and the South Acropolis. In front of the artificial platform supporting the temple structure is a depression that was used as one of the city's reservoirs. [4]
